Let's do this then, percentages based on lv50.
If you do only STR/AGI or INT/AGI
41 STR or 41 INT= 82 ATK, 1.8% Parry
41 AGI = 3.7% CRIT, 1.8% Dodge
If you do only STR/INT
41 STR = 82 ATK, 1.8% Parry
41 INT = 82 ATK, 1.8% Parry
Tota = 164 ATK, 3.7% Parry (rounding error)
If you do STR/INT/AGI
33 STR + 33 INT = 132 ATK, 3% Parry
32 AGI = 2.9% CRIT, 1.4% Dodge
Now what all the guides say isn't totally wrong, you need both STR and INT, no exceptions. Just from this, you can see that a balance of STR and INT is where you'll get the most of your ATK and parry. This counts for cards also. What depends on you though is just HOW MUCH stats you want for each attribute.
